A William and Mary period oak court cupboard. The frieze is carved with trailing vines, inscribed R. S. G and dated 1700. The centre section with turned pendants and three panels incorporating two cupboard doors is further decorated with fruiting vines. Raised over a base section with two drawers and another pair of cupboard doors. With reeded mouldings and iron hinges, 150cm high, 121cm wide, 41cm deep.Condition report intended as a guide only.Mostly original. Some alterations including door locks. Very good colour. Top boards probably replacements, the timber is ancient with the front board having a split on the left hand side, the rear most board cracked from the right to the centre and with cured infestation to the left back corner.Top section lacking shelf with some supports still in place. Back boards all running horizontally, of sturdy oak and chamfered to fit into the frame, thought to be original. Some more signs of wood worm damage to the rear. Drawer runners likely replaced. Inner shelf an oak faced softwood replacement as is the base board.

AN 18TH CENTURY WALNUT EIGHT-DAY LONGCASE CLOCK, SIGNED R. HENDERSON, SCARBOROUGH, the 12-inch break-arch brass dial with rolling moon, subsidiary seconds and date, the hood with blind-fretwork carving and brass mounted stop-fluted columns, the case with moulded arch-top door, raised on bun feet. 249cmThe movement and dial fit well to the case but we can't warrant their authenticity. The handsome case with a few old repairs but generally in good condition. With two weights, pendulum and case key.
